How Malvern families cover it
Most families layer several sources rather than relying on one. Usually it starts with private savings and Social Security, and long-term-care insurance kicks in next if there's a policy in place. Wartime veterans and surviving spouses should check VA Aid & Attendance through the Corporal Michael J. Crescenz VA Medical Center. And Pennsylvania's Community HealthChoices (CHC), along with the LIFE program, can cover care services — though not room and board — for seniors who meet the functional and financial tests, after a nursing-facility level-of-care assessment. Breaking down ccrc entry fees explained in Malvern
CCRCs layer a large refundable-or-not entrance fee on top of the monthly rate; the contract terms determine how much you get back and how much future care is guaranteed.
What ccrcs includes in Pennsylvania
A Continuing Care Retirement Community (CCRC) spans independent living, assisted living, and skilled nursing on one campus, so a resident can age in place as needs change.
The assisted living portion is licensed as a Personal Care Home or Assisted Living Residence by DHS, and the skilled-nursing portion is DOH-licensed under 28 Pa. Code Chapter 211, with CCRC contracts governed by Pennsylvania insurance and consumer-contract law. A typical monthly range is $3,200 to $6,800 a month plus a significant entrance fee.
Before you tour, know what actually predicts quality:
- the entrance-fee refund terms in the contract
- the financial health of the operator and its reserves
- guaranteed access to higher levels of care and at what price
